CourseDetails
• Introduction to Migration Health Promotion: Defining migration health promotion, its importance, and principles. Understanding the determinants of health for migrants.
• Global Migration Trends: Analyzing the patterns of international migration, forced migration, and internal displacement. Examining the health implications of these movements.
• Health Assessments for Migrants: Conducting comprehensive health assessments, including screening, vaccinations, and mental health evaluations. Understanding legal and ethical considerations.
• Cultural Competence in Health Care: Developing cultural awareness, knowledge, and skills to provide effective and respectful care to migrants from diverse backgrounds.
• Preventing Communicable Diseases: Implementing evidence-based interventions for infectious diseases, such as tuberculosis, HIV, and malaria, prevalent among migrant populations.
• Mental Health and Psychosocial Support: Addressing the mental health needs of migrants, including trauma, grief, and loss, and providing psychosocial support.
• Reproductive Health and Gender-based Violence: Providing sexual and reproductive health services and addressing gender-based violence among migrant populations.
• Occupational Health and Safety: Ensuring safe and healthy working conditions for migrant workers and addressing occupational health risks.
• Policy and Advocacy: Advocating for the rights and health of migrants at local, national, and international levels. Understanding the role of policy in promoting migration health.
• Monitoring and Evaluation: Developing indicators and tools to monitor and evaluate migration health promotion interventions, ensuring accountability and continuous improvement.
